NOAA's Atlantic Real-Time Ocean Forecast System (RTOFS) is a data-assimilating nowcast-forecast system operated by the National Centers for Environmental Prediction (NCEP). The model runs daily, producing a forecast out to 120 hours. NCEI provides access to 3D gridded data with standard depths with a 24-hour output time step, and surface data with a 1-hour output time step. When one hears the phrase, "wind shear is 20 knots over the hurricane", this typically refers to the difference in wind speed between 200 mb (the top of the troposphere, 40,000 feet altitude) and a layer where a pressure of 850 mb is found-about 5,000 feet above the surface. The Atlantic Ocean is the second-largest of the world's five oceans, with an area of about 85,133,000 km 2 (32,870,000 sq mi). [2] It covers approximately 17% of Earth's surface and about 24% of its water surface area. For more information contact New York ARINC at +1-631-589-7272. *Flights may call on-ground VHF for HF frequency assignments at the designated gateways or on the extended range VHF when ...Atlantic Ocean - Climate, Currents, Winds: Weather over the North Atlantic is largely determined by large-scale wind currents and air masses emanating from North America. Near Iceland, atmospheric pressure tends to be low, and air flows in a counterclockwise direction. Conversely, air flows clockwise around the Azores, a high-pressure area. High Frequency (HF) Radar derived surface currents have provided critical support to maritime operations and water quality monitoring since 2005. Currents in the ocean are equivalent to winds in the atmosphere because they move things from one location to another. A place on man... how much is jcpenney starting pay This product is based on the OVATION model and provides a 30 to 90 minute forecast of the location and intensity of the aurora. The forecast lead time is the time it takes for the solar wind to travel from the L1 observation point to Earth. The two maps show the North and South poles of Earth respectively.
